网上作业JAVA程序设计第一次.docx_第1页
网上作业JAVA程序设计第一次.docx_第2页
网上作业JAVA程序设计第一次.docx_第3页
网上作业JAVA程序设计第一次.docx_第4页
网上作业JAVA程序设计第一次.docx_第5页
已阅读5页,还剩7页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2016年9月网上考试作业JAVA程序设计第一次一 、 单项选择题 (共 20 题、54 / 60 分 ) 1、给定程序如下 public static void main(String args) Float f=new Float(4.2f); Float c; Double d=new Double(4.2); float fl=4.2f; c=f; 下列选项中( )的值为真. A、f.equls(d) B、c=f C、c=d D、c.equls(f)收藏该题 得分 3 / 3 难度 4 正确答案 D 解题方法 2、下列说法不正确的是( ) A、java语言里的线程是没有优先级的 B、String类在java.lang包中 C、java语言支持类的序列化 D、能序列化的类必须实现java.io.Serializable接口收藏该题 得分 3 / 3 难度 4 正确答案 A 解题方法 3、如果有类Person和其子类Man和Woman,则如果程序中出现语句Woman w=new Man();下列说法正确的是( ) A、语句错误 B、语句正确 C、编译正确但运行错误 D、以上均不对收藏该题 得分 3 / 3 难度 4 正确答案 A 解题方法 4、执行下列语句String foo = “ABCDE”; foo.substring(3); foo.concat(“XYZ”)后,变量foo的值为( ) A、ABCDE B、ABCXYZ C、ABCDEXYZ D、CDEXYZ收藏该题 得分 3 / 3 难度 4 正确答案 A 解题方法 5、下列哪个是接口MouseMotionListener的方法( ) A、public void mouseMoved(MouseEvent) B、public boolean mouseMoved(MouseEvent) C、public void mouseMoved(MouseMotionEvent) D、public boolean MouseMoved(MouseMotionEvent)收藏该题 得分 3 / 3 难度 4 正确答案 A 解题方法 6、下列哪个选项不会出现编译错误( ) A、float f = 1.3; B、char c = a; C、byte b = 257; D、int i = 10;收藏该题 得分 3 / 3 难度 4 正确答案 D 解题方法 7、在一个应用程序中有如下定义:int a=1,2,3,4,5,6,7,8,9,10;为了打印输出数组a的最后一个元素,下面正确的代码是( ) A、System.out.println(a10); B、System.out.println(a9); C、System.out.println(aa.length); D、System.out.println(a(8);收藏该题 得分 3 / 3 难度 4 正确答案 B 解题方法 8、下列哪个选项不能使当前线程停止执行( ) A、一个异常被抛出 B、线程执行了sleep()调用 C、高优先级的线程处于可运行状态 D、当前线程产生了一个新线程收藏该题 得分 3 / 3 难度 4 正确答案 D 解题方法 9、下列对常量MAX定义正确的是( ) A、public int MAX =100; B、static int MAX =100; C、final public int MAX =100; D、public final int MAX =100.收藏该题 得分 3 / 3 难度 4 正确答案 D 解题方法 10、如果定义一个线程类,它继承自Thread,则我们必须重写其中的( )方法 A、run B、start C、yield D、stop收藏该题 得分 3 / 3 难度 4 正确答案 A 解题方法 11、下列不属于构成元素的是 A、消息的接收者 B、消息的发送者 C、消息所需参数 D、消息所对应的方法名收藏该题 得分 0 / 3 难度 5 正确答案 B 解题方法 12、下列哪个方法可以创建一个新线程() A、继承javlang.Thread并重写方法run B、继承javlang.Runnable并重写start方法 C、实现javlang.thread 并重写方法run D、实现javlang.Thread并重写方法start收藏该题 得分 3 / 3 难度 5 正确答案 A 解题方法 13、有如下程序段x的取值在什么范围内时,将打印出字符串second? A、x 0 B、x -4 C、x = -4 D、x -4收藏该题 得分 3 / 3 难度 5 正确答案 D 解题方法 14、String s = hello; String t = hello; char c = h,e,l,l,o ; 下列哪些表达式返回true( ) A、s.equals(t) B、t.equals(c) C、s=t D、以上均不对收藏该题 得分 3 / 3 难度 5 正确答案 A 解题方法 15、以下选项中循环结构合法的是( ) A、 B、 C、 D、收藏该题 得分 3 / 3 难度 5 正确答案 C 解题方法 16、欲构造ArrayList类的一个实例,此类继承了List接口,下列哪个方法是正确的 ? ( ) A、ArrayList myList=new Object( ); B、List myList=new ArrayList( ); C、ArrayList myList=new List( ); D、List myList=new List( );收藏该题 得分 0 / 3 难度 5 正确答案 B 解题方法 17、如果有Boolean a=new Boolean(“yes”),则booleanValue( )值为( A、yes B、“yes” C、true D、false收藏该题 得分 3 / 3 难度 5 正确答案 D 解题方法 18、下列程序段执行后t1的结果是:( ) A、6 B、9 C、11 D、3收藏该题 得分 3 / 3 难度 5 正确答案 B 解题方法 19、为AB类的一个无形式参数无返回值的方法method书写方法头,使得使用类名AB作为前缀就可以调用它,该方法头的形式为( ) A、static void method( ) B、public void method( ) C、final void method( ) D、abstract void method( )收藏该题 得分 3 / 3 难度 5 正确答案 A 解题方法 20、一个文件名为first的Java源文件,编译后得到的类文件为() A、first.java B、first.class C、first.c D、上述均不对收藏该题 得分 3 / 3 难度 5 正确答案 B 解题方法 二 、 判断题 (共 20 题、40 / 40 分 ) 1、Java语言支持类的序列化.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 正确 解题方法 2、字符串 a 的长度是5.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 错误 解题方法 3、Java类文件可以既是Application又是Applet.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 正确 解题方法 4、所有的变量在使用前都必须进行初始化.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 错误 解题方法 5、事件源不能自己监听自己产生的事件.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 错误 解题方法 6、socket类在java.lang中.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 错误 解题方法 7、Java中的消息包括消息的接收者,接受者所用方法,方法所需参数三个部分.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 正确 解题方法 8、声明为final的方法不能被重写.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 正确 解题方法 9、复合语句虽然由多条语句构成,但从功能上可视为一条语句,是一个整体 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 正确 解题方法 10、通过类FileOutputStream可以实现对文件的随机处理.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 错误 解题方法 11、for 语句中的循环体不能是空的.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 错误 解题方法 12、Java 支持多线程机制.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 正确 解题方法 13、所有的文件输入/输出流都继承于InputStream类/OutputStream类。 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 错误 解题方法 14、子类的对象能直接向其父类对象赋值.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 正确 解题方法 15、类Connection完成对指定数据库的连接操作.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 正确 解题方法 16、数据报通信协议(UDP)是一种面向连接的协议.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 错误 解题方法 17、Applet执行过程中可以多次运行init方法和stop方法.( ) 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 错误 解题方法 18、throws是java的关键字 正确 错误收藏该题 得分 2 / 2 难度 4 正确答案 正确 解题方法 19、抽象类中至

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论